Biography

Dr. Prasert Prasarttong-Osoth is a prominent Thai businessman and a former surgeon, born on March 22, 1933. He is well-known as the founder and owner of Bangkok Airways and Bangkok Dusit Medical Services (BDMS), Thailand’s largest private healthcare network. Prasert earned his medical degree from the Faculty of Medicine at Siriraj Hospital, Mahidol University, and furthered his education at Imperial College London. Starting his career as a medical doctor, he transitioned into business and founded BDMS in 1972. Under his leadership, BDMS expanded into a regional healthcare powerhouse with a wide network of hospitals across Thailand. Prasert also established Bangkok Airways, which began as a small charter service and grew into a significant regional airline. His business acumen extends to various sectors, including healthcare, aviation, and media, making him a notable figure in Thai business circles. Despite his success, Prasert faced legal issues in 2019 when the Securities and Exchange Commission of Thailand fined him and his daughter 500 million baht for insider trading of Bangkok Airways share

Prominent achievements

Founder and Chief Executive Officer of Bangkok Dusit Medical Services, the largest private healthcare group in Thailand. Chief Executive Officer and Vice Chairman of Bangkok Airways. Notable for transforming Bangkok Dusit Medical Services into a key player in the regional healthcare sector. Previously listed by Forbes with an estimated net worth of $2.5 billion as of 2015

On 2025-07-24, presided over the installation of the Royal Garuda at Bangkok International Hospital, marking it as the 48th hospital in the BDMS network.

Personal life

The Prasarttong-Osoth family has a significant presence in Thailand’s corporate world. Prasert's daughter, Paramaporn Prasarttong-Osoth, has made a notable debut in the wealth rankings, with a net worth of approximately 13.85 billion baht as of recent data. Additionally, the family's total stock holdings in various ventures, including Bangkok Airways and Bangkok Dusit Medical Services, have positioned them among the richest families in Thailand
